Description supplied by school: 

The Caledonian Language is a small, friendly school, in central Edinburgh. We aim to help students become independent learners, so we have a self-access room, where you can continue studying English when your class finishes for the day. Our English courses are good value for money, and offer students a positive learning experience. The school also gives support in settling into life in Edinburgh, whether you want to find a flat or a job, or a sports club.

I am a 55 years old man, currently working as G.P. in Spain and I went to Caledonian Language School in Edinburgh in August for 4 week and my experience couldn't have been better. - Although it is a small school, they have a very high quality teachers who are able to attend your weak points in your learing process. We always were less than 10 students per classroom that is very important in order to improve your pronounciation -As accomodation, I choosed a homestay. It was good placed, 10 minutes walking to the school and city center. Having dinner or breakfast I learnt more because my family host helped my at any moment in my learning process. - Edinburgh is really a friendly city where people is absolutely easy interact with
